    New 2025 Dodge Pricing Lineup Delivers Most Horsepower in Class Under $50K in Dodge Durango R/T, Most Horsepower in Class Under $30K in Dodge Hornet GT

    AUBURN HILLS, Mich., March 5, 2025 /PRNewswire/ --

    Dodge is putting performance in the price range of even more horsepower-loving enthusiasts with the repositioning of the 2025 Dodge Durango and Dodge Hornet GT. The Dodge Durango R/T (pictured) has the most horsepower in its class for under $50,000, and the Dodge Hornet GT has the most horsepower in its class under $30,000.

    • Dodge brand is repositioning 2025 Dodge Durango lineup and 2025 Dodge Hornet GT to make horsepower more affordable for all
    • 360-horsepower 2025 Dodge Durango R/T, the only vehicle in its class with a V-8 engine, now available at a starting U.S. MSRP less than $50,000 (all prices exclude destination cost of $1,595, taxes and fees)
    • 268-horsepower 2025 Dodge Hornet GT offers the most horsepower in its segment at a U.S. MSRP priced less than $30,000
    • 710-horsepower Dodge Durango SRT Hellcat, the quickest, fastest and most powerful three-row gas SUV, now delivers more horsepower per dollar with a new starting U.S. MSRP of $84,995
    • Entry-level Durango GT available at starting U.S. MSRP of $38,495
    • New pricing on the 2025 Dodge Durango lineup and 2025 Dodge Hornet GT will be available at Dodge dealerships starting March 6

    The Dodge brand is putting more muscle behind its performance pricing, repositioning its 2025 SUV and CUV performance lineup to make horsepower and performance even more affordable for all.

    "Dodge is putting performance in the price range of even more horsepower-loving enthusiasts with the repositioning of the 2025 Dodge Durango and Dodge Hornet GT," said Matt McAlear, Dodge CEO. "Customers can bring home the Dodge Durango R/T, the only vehicle in its class with an available V-8 engine, for under $50,000, and the turbo-charged Dodge Hornet GT, with the ability to move from zero to 60 mph in 6.5 seconds, for less than $30,000." 

    New pricing on the 2025 Dodge Durango and Dodge Hornet GT will be available at Dodge dealerships starting on March 6.

    Dodge Durango

    The 2025 Dodge Durango R/T will now feature a starting U.S. manufacturer's suggested retail price (MSRP) of $49,995. In addition, the 710-horsepower 2025 Dodge Durango SRT Hellcat, the quickest, fastest and most powerful three-row gas SUV, will also now deliver more horsepower per dollar with a new starting U.S. MSRP of $84,995. The entry-level Dodge Durango GT now starts at a U.S. MSRP of $38,495 (all prices exclude destination cost of $1,595, taxes and fees).

    Standard content on the 2025 Dodge Durango R/T, which offers the most horsepower in its segment priced less than a U.S. MSRP of $50,000, includes all-wheel drive; a best-in-class 360-horsepower and 390 lb.-ft. of torque HEMI® V-8 engine; 7,200-pound towing capacity; seven-passenger seating; 10.1-inch touchscreen with Uconnect 5 system,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to; Blind-spot Monitoring; seven standard air bags; Rear Cross Path detection and more.

    The supercharged 2025 Dodge Durango SRT Hellcat, powered by the 6.2-liter HEMI Hellcat V-8 engine, also packs a large lineup of standard content. Standard features of the Durango SRT Hellcat include SRT Performance Pages; configurable Drive Modes for more vehicle control; race options that allow the driver to activate, deactivate and adjust the rpm values for Launch Control and Shift Light features; TorqueFlite 8HP95 eight-speed automatic transmission; steering-wheel-mounted paddles for manual-style shifting; seven available Drive modes; and a 10.1-inch touchscreen, to name just a few features.

    Dodge Hornet

    The 2025 Dodge Hornet GT with standard all-wheel drive is now available at a starting U.S. MSRP of $29,995, delivering the most horsepower in its segment under a U.S. MSRP of $30,000.

    Also standard is a Sport Mode that unlocks a sharper throttle, optimized shift schedule, access to full power and torque and a tighter steering wheel feel; 12.3-inch digital TFT cluster; 10.25-inch touchscreen with Uconnect 5 system; dual zone HVAC, L1 advanced driver assist systems and more.

    For 110 years, the Dodge brand has carried on the spirit of brothers John and Horace Dodge. Their influence continues today as Dodge, America's performance brand, shifts into high gear with a lineup that delivers unrivaled performance in each of the segments in which the brand competes while moving forward to a future that includes electrified muscle in the form of the next-generation, all-new Dodge Charger.

    The next-generation Dodge Charger electrifies a legend, with the Charger retaining its title as the world's quickest and most powerful muscle car, led by the all-new, all-electric 2025 Dodge Charger Daytona Scat Pack. The all-new Dodge Charger will also offer performance choices via multi-energy powertrain options, including the 550-horsepower Dodge Charger SIXPACK H.O., powered by the 3.0L Twin Turbo Hurricane High Output engine.

    Dodge also keeps its foot on the gas as a pure performance brand with the 710-horsepower Dodge Durango SRT Hellcat, the most powerful gas engine SUV ever, and best-in-class standard performance in the compact-utility vehicle segment with the Dodge Hornet.

    Dodge is part of the portfolio of brands offered by leading global automaker and mobility provider Stellantis. For more information regarding Stellantis (NYSE:STLA), please visit www.stellantis.com.
